Browning Knob

Browning Knob was named in honor of R. Gerry Browning, 1884–1966, who served as location and claims engineer and parkway consultant for the North Carolina State Highway Commission from 1925 to 1964. His forceful presentation of the high-quality scenery found in North Carolina secured the route through Western North Carolina and Cherokee Indian lands to the Great Smoky Mountains National Park. With consideration and courtesy for those involved, he worked untiringly to secure the rights-of-way for this spectacular mountain parkway. During the construction of the parkway he ably represented North Carolina in its dealings with the National Park Service. His love of the mountains was surpassed only by his love of people.
